Your key responsibilitieswill include:
- Attend to patient enquiries over the counter to provide information on clinic services
- Update patient registration information and process medical records in accordance with standard operating procedures and clinic guidelines
- Liaise with medical teams and patients in making appointments across different medical specialties / clinics / inpatient within the Group
- Assist doctors and nurses in basic clinical tasks when required
- Collate laboratory and radiology results for doctor's review and follow up
- Perform daily billings and accurate transactions, including closing of accounts
- Ad-hoc administrative tasks
